Ticket: Staging env misconfigured for Siftgate bloom filter

The bloom layer in front of the Pellet KV store is rejecting all lookups in staging because the env file was copied from the dev template without credentials. False-positive tuning values are fine; only the auth line is missing. To unblock the weekly demo, the Pellet admission secret must be set on the following line.

env line for yaguf-fajop: LEDGER_TOKEN13=fb08984397349

Subject: Kiosk watchdog cut-over — done

Team, the Perchline kiosk fleet is now on the new watchdog. Old behavior: hard reboot after three missed heartbeats. New behavior: app restart first, reboot only if that fails twice. Expect fewer full reboots in your ticket queue, but restart events will show up in the kiosk log under a new tag. Cut-over finished last night; two kiosks in the Welton depot needed manual kicks, both fine now. All fleet units now run with the following values.

settings of tagef-bawif:
DRUIX_HOST=druix.zemvarlabs.internal
DRUIX_PORT=8000

Welcome to reviewing PickPath, our warehouse pick-list optimizer at Quarrow Logistics. Changes to the routing heuristics in optimizer/core require a benchmark run against the Fennwick depot dataset before approval. Merged builds are packaged nightly and pushed to the depot controllers, which verify each artifact's signature. To validate packages locally during review, use the deploy key below.

rollout seal: bky4_DFM9

Changelog 3.8.1 — Murmur alert deduplicator (key rotation)

For new team members: Murmur collapses duplicate on-call alerts before they reach the pager, and every release artifact it consumes must carry a valid signature. On the 14th we rotated the deploy signing key as part of our quarterly schedule; the old key was revoked the same day, so any pipeline still referencing it will fail verification with a clear rotation notice. Update your local signing config to use the current key, which follows below.

release key, hadug-kawef: bky13_mPGeFZeR1GZ1G